Specifications:
- Processor: Intel Core i5-11400 2.60GHz (up to 4.4 GHz)
- Storage: 4TB PCIe SSD
- Memory: 16GB DDR4 DIMM
- Graphics: NVIDIA GTX 1650 SUPER 4GB GDDR6
- Operating System: Windows 10 Pro-64
- Connectivity: 802.11ax Wifi, Bluetooth 5.2, Ethernet LAN (RJ-45)
- Ports: 4 USB 3.2 Gen1, 2 USB 2.0, 1 HDMI, 2 Display Port (DP), USB 3.2 Type-C Gen2

Pros & Cons
👍 Pros
- Equipped with an Intel Core i5-11400 Hexa Core processor for strong multi-threaded performance in gaming and applications
- Features an NVIDIA GTX 1650 SUPER 4GB GDDR6 dedicated graphics card, suitable for playing popular titles
- Offers a spacious 4TB PCIe NVMe SSD, providing substantial storage and fast loading times for games and software
- Includes 16GB DDR4 DIMM RAM, facilitating smooth multitasking and responsive gaming experiences
- Comes with a Dockztorm USB Hub, adding convenience for connecting multiple peripherals right away
👎 Cons
- The NVIDIA GTX 1650 SUPER, while capable, is not a top-tier graphics card and may struggle with the newest, most demanding games at high settings
- The system uses air cooling for the CPU, which might be less efficient for extreme overclocking compared to liquid cooling solutions
- The 400W power supply could limit future upgrades to more powerful graphics cards or components that require higher wattage
- The absence of a webcam means users will need to purchase an external camera for video calls or streaming
- The desktop comes with Windows 10 Pro-64, which some users might prefer to upgrade to Windows 11 for the latest features
